Understanding Blockchain Gaming: A Confluence of Technology and Culture
Blockchain gaming refers to the integration of blockchain protocols into video game ecosystems, facilitating decentralized assets, secure transactions, and transparent economies. Unlike conventional gaming, where digital assets are often stored solely on centralized servers, blockchain-enabled games grant players true ownership of in-game items, characters, and currency as non-fungible tokens (NFTs). This development addresses long-standing issues related to asset control, resale, and cross-platform interoperability.

Gaming Innovation: Player Ownership and Digital Economies
| Aspect | Traditional Games | Blockchain Games |
|---|---|---|
| Asset Ownership | Controlled by developers; limited transferability | Player-owned assets as NFTs; transferable across platforms |
| Economies | In-game currency without real-world value | Real-world value; trading, staking, and investment opportunities |
| Community Engagement | Limited stakeholder participation | Player-driven economies foster active communities |
By enabling asset ownership, blockchain games foster ecological ecosystems where players can monetize their efforts, participate in governance, and influence game evolution. This paradigm shift challenges conventional business models and demands adaptation from industry stakeholders.
The Role of Play-and-Earn Models in Driving Adoption
The rise of play-to-earn (P2E) models underscores the potential of blockchain gaming to redefine value exchange. P2E games reward players not only with entertainment but also with tangible assets that can be traded or sold externally. The success of projects like Axie Infinity exemplifies how blockchain-based games are cultivating economic opportunities, especially in regions with limited traditional employment options.
However, the adoption of these models involves navigating complex issues such as regulatory uncertainty, market volatility, and scalability. Industry leaders emphasize the importance of sustainable designs that prioritize user protection and long-term growth.

Looking Forward: Challenges and Opportunities
Despite rapid progress, blockchain gaming faces significant hurdles including technological scalability, regulatory frameworks, and mainstream consumer adoption. However, with ongoing innovations in Layer 2 solutions and increasing institutional interest, the trajectory remains optimistic.
Moreover, collaborations between traditional gaming giants and blockchain startups are fostering hybrid environments where innovation can thrive without compromising user experience or security. Establishing industry best practices and fostering community trust will be vital in translating blockchain gaming from pioneering experiments to everyday entertainment.
